What Exactly Is The LG IMS App?

The IMS app is a standard feature found on every LG phone, allowing users to utilize 4G LTE and 5G networks for texting. Despite its usefulness, LG customers have reported encountering problems with the app not functioning due to LG IMS.

Multiple users have reported receiving an error message indicating that the LG IMS app has stopped working. This issue appears to be affecting LG phones on T-Mobile and Metro T-Mobile networks, but the positive news is that the company has begun investigating these problems.

  • Disabling The Application Might Help

In case you are unable to use WiFi calling or VoLTE services due to LG IMS keeps stopping errors, you can disable the app on your LG phone to avoid the issue. Follow these steps to disable it:

  1. Dial 277634#*# on your device.
  2. Select Field Test and then Modem Settings.
  3. Toggle VoLTE on/off.
  4. Restart your device to complete the process.

Learn More About LG IMS

It’s important to note that LG IMS is not a virus or spyware. Some users may associate it with malware due to its functionality, but this system app is not malicious. Using features like WiFi calling or other IP multimedia functions does not result in unauthorized data transmission to third parties.
